Grid Connected Inverter Reference Design (Rev. D)
The design supports two modes of operation for the inverter: a voltage source mode using an output LC filter, and a grid connected mode with an output LCL filter.

Operating Modes of Energy Storage Inverters (PCS)
In grid-connected mode, the energy storage inverter is linked to the utility grid and performs both charging and discharging functions. It acts as a current source, synchronized with the grid frequency.
